Why is the Tulsi plant significant in Indian homes?

The Tulsi plant holds immense significance in Indian homes due to its religious and medicinal importance. It is considered a sacred plant in Hinduism, often planted indoors or in courtyards where it is worshipped daily. The belief is that Tulsi promotes spiritual well-being, purifies the surrounding air, and brings positive energy. Additionally, it is renowned in Ayurvedic medicine for its adaptogenic properties that enhance resilience to stress.
